Abstract This material deals with the effects of the main traits of the Snowflake generation,
namely, exacerbated ego (hypersensitivity), overdeveloped individualism (selfishness) and fear.
This typology of young people born between 1980 and 2000, known as the Me Generation has
been approximated in the past by Constantin Rddulescu Motru by the concept of anarchic
personality which is the opposite of energetic personality To understand whether the young
people of the Me Generation belong to one of the two categories, I will first make some
theoretical clarifications.

1. Conceptual delimitations
1.1. Personality in Constantin Radulescu Motru's vision
To be able to talk about anarchic and energetic personality, the term personality must
first be clarified from a theoretical viewpoint. This term, Constantin Radulescu Motru means a
set of skills that help you accomplish a task. This determination is impossible without ego-
consciousness (Radulescu-Motru, 1984: 552). In other words, personality is closely linked to
the individual's ability to have a purpose in life. Vocation is from this viewpoint the greatest
lever of progress (Radulescu-Motru, 1984: 521). The man who seeks to find and follow his
vocation is a transformer of energy. He is the prophet of energetic personalism, toward which
the whole of reality is evolving. (Radulescu-Motru, 1984: 521). Vocation plays a particularly
important role in society because in it the highest moral and intellectual qualities of the soul
are embodied together. It is therefore no coincidence that the people who have had more men
of vocation have progressed the most (Radulescu-Motru, 1984: 521). This perspective is
important because it raises the question of social change, which depends on how generations
actively involve themselves, and implicitly in accordance with their vocation, in responding to
the challenges of the times (the thesis of the generational entelechy of the German sociologist
Karl Mannheim is taken up here) (Mannheim, 1952: 307). Returning to vocation, it can be said
that its main merit lies in making man responsible for himself (Radulescu-Motru, 1984: 521).
According to Radulescu Motru, personality crystallizes around the ego, but the
structure of personality includes, besides the ego, many other soul elements. The ego is the flash
of lightning that reveals where the soul's anticipation is leading! The personality is the solid
machinery that mediates the realization of anticipation (Radulescu-Motru, 1984: 557). In
other words, alongside vocation, personality has a close relationship with the ego because when
we have the correspondence between ego and personality, the result is vocation (Radulescu-
Motru, 1984.: 558). Here, a clear distinction must be made between ego and personality. The
ego is the permanent feeling, or rather the feeling of man's superiority in relation to his
environment (Radulescu-Motru, 1984: 559). Personality, on the other hand is a
systematization of varied and externally multi-linked soul acts. It begins having a structure
through the impulse given by the self, but once the structure has begun, it continues to develop
through the incorporation of many elements foreign to the self (Radulescu-Motru, 1984).
